BLAKE
BLAKE is a Texas oil lease in Reeves County, Railroad Commission district 08, operated by Williams Oil Company. It has 1 wellbore on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from January 1993 to July 1994, totalling 2,042 barrels. The lease is not currently producing. Its strongest month on the record we hold was March 1993, at 245 barrels.
